The majority of a forensic scientist's time is spent _____.

Biology
2 answers:
Roman55 [17]3 years ago
6 0

Answer: Investigating physical evidence.

Explanation:

Forensic scientists pay a lot of time to analyze the evidences. The analysis process is time consuming, requires labor, skill, expertise and technology. The analysis process may take few hours to many days depending upon the obtained evidences. They analyze the results and frame them in expert testimony in such a way so that these can be used for the purpose of conviction of the culprit.

Which part of photosynthesis is represented by the diagram to the right
Yanka [14]

Answer:

<em>Light-dependent reactions</em>

<em></em>

Explanation:

Photosynthesis occurs in two stages: light-dependent reactions and light independent-reactions. This last stage is often called Calvin cycle.

The diagram shows reactions occurred in the thylakoid membranes which are located inside the chloroplasts. Therefore, we can identify that these reactions are the light-dependent reactions. During this part of photosynthesis, the energy from the sunlight is absorbed by a pigment called chlorophyl (Chl). Then, it is sequentially coverted into chemical energy stored in the form of molecules: NADPH (nitotinamide adenine dinucleotide phosphate) and ATP (adenosine triphosphate).
